In CTA Advanced Technical you will be tested on the depth of your technical knowledge in the areas of taxation which you choose. You can choose two areas most relevant to your work based tax specialism to focus on, and learn about how to identify and solve tax issues.

Exams

You must register with CIOT as a student at least four months in advance of taking your first exam. Each Advanced Technical paper is a ‘stand alone’ paper, exam details include:


Sittings: Every six months, with exams in May and November.


Time: 3 hours 30 minutes with no reading time.


Questions: Five or six long-style questions for either 10, 15, or 20 marks each (totalling 100 marks).


Format: Mix of computational and written questions.


Pass mark: 50%, and you’ll receive a credit in that paper.


Pathways

There are two pathways to achieving this qualification, depending on whether you're exempt from the Awareness paper.

You are exempt

Complete in 12 months


CBEs:

Law, Ethics, Accounting


Sitting 1:

Select first Advanced Technical Paper


Sitting 2:

Select second Advanced Technical Paper and the matching Application and Professional Skills Paper

Not exempt

Complete in 18 months


CBEs:

Law, Ethics, Accounting


Sitting 1:

Awareness Paper


Sitting 2:

Select first Advanced Technical Paper


Sitting 3:

Select second Advanced Technical Paper and the matching Application and Professional Skills Paper

Tip: If you are a qualified accountant (ACCA with ATX, ICAEW, ICAI, ICAS) or qualified ATT, you may be exempt from the Awareness paper.

Also, because the technical knowledge required for the Application and Professional Skills paper closely aligns with the related Advanced Technical paper, it’s recommended to take both at the same time.

What’s included

For Classroom and Live Online, we offer both tuition and revision courses for CTA Advanced Technical. On tuition courses the focus is on learning the key areas of the syllabus covered in the course workbook, laying down a foundation of technical knowledge. Revision courses build upon this knowledge, focusing upon exam question practice and technique to prepare you for the real exam. Distance Learning is a complete course so you do not need to choose the individual elements.

Tuition courses

  • Study Manuals and accompanying Question Banks

    The Study Manuals cover the syllabus for each course and are the key source of your learning material. The Question Banks are designed to test your understanding of the fundamental principles covered in each chapter in the corresponding Study Manual.
  • Course Workbooks and Workbook Q&A*

    These detail the core areas of the syllabus which will be covered during the Classroom and Live Online courses, incorporating worked examples. Additional questions to attempt in class are provided in the workbook Q&A section.
  • Pre-revision question bank

    Contains more challenging questions for you to consolidate your knowledge of the full syllabus for each paper.
  • Course exam

    A marked assessment that has been designed to test your understanding of the material covered during your studies. It is taken during the tuition phase and is at a simpler level designed to test your knowledge as you work through the content.
  • Pre-revision mock

    Designed to be attempted after you’ve worked through the pre-revision question bank. The pre-revision mock is harder than the course exam, designed to prepare you for the revision phase of your studies.

* Available for Classroom or Live Online learners.

Revision courses

  • Revision question bank

    Contains exam standard questions and recent past papers, all with answers updated to the relevant Finance Act, providing excellent final preparation for the exam.
  • Revision mock

    To be attempted after you have worked through the revision question bank. This is an exam standard exam designed to prepare you for sitting the real exam.
  • Memory joggers

    Short summaries of the key rules covered in each chapter of the study manuals, and also include any useful proformas. They are designed to refresh your knowledge on any areas you’re stuck on as you work your way through the revision question bank.
